VideopSpy v3.0 – more options to hide your private media

VideopSpy v3.0 - Image 1

We’ve previously seen a PRX module which lets you hide your files via the XMB. Today though, we’ve got a full blown app that allows you to make some sensitive media files of yours (videos and pictures) hidden.

The interesting thing about VideopSpy is that when accessed via the XMB, it looks like a normal homebrew calculator application. See the screencap above? Nothing suspicious about that right? And it’s only when you input your correct code that your hidden files show up. Smaaart.

After a few months since the release of version 2.0, transce080 (previously known as dark420bishop) has finally come up with a new update which gives you a lot more options in hiding your sensitive files. VideopSpy v3.0 has the following details in its changelog:

  • Rewritten from scratch in C
  • Major graphical face-lift
  • New Instant Action mode
  • Expanded to include more directories

The readme is very comprehensive in that it has easy-to-follow installation instructions and other notes on FW/CFW compatibility. There’s a section which explains how to hide (and unhide) your files, and an informative troubleshooting/FAQ guide that you can refer to just in case things get tricky, so make sure you take a look at the readme.
